Big Corn has the right answer... Drilled 13 wells for a site many years ago , wound up putting 3 wells together 3/4 mile away to get the quantity needed. Son needed new well for building site, first hole no dice. 60' away and 120' deep for hole #2 has more water than the above 3 wells together. First 2 wells of the 13 were over 900' deep, 600' into the bedrock- trying to keep it close. I would recommend finding water before getting too far down the construction route.
